ENGINE THAT SHAKES ON Mercedes Classe C 4: CRANKSHAFT PULLEY

The first source that can cause your engine to shake on Mercedes Classe C 4 is the crankshaft pulley. And yes, this pulley, also called the damper pulley, is there to decrease the vibrations of your engine block, if it is cracked, the first sign is that your engine will move, program to verify its condition, because eventually it can trigger your engine block to break.

ENGINE vibrations ON Mercedes Classe C 4: SPARK PLUGS

Another explanation that can lead to your engine shaking on Mercedes Classe C 4 is if one or more of your spark plugs are dirty or dead. In this circumstance, the spark will not appear and as a consequence the explosion in one or more of your cylinders will not be generated. The result is that your engine block will run poorly and will deliver vibrations, so check the connections of your spark plugs and the condition of the spark plugs themselves.

ENGINE THAT MOVES ON Mercedes Classe C 4: CARDAN SHAFTS

Finally, sometimes you get the impression that the vibrations are caused by the engine of our Mercedes Classe C 4, but in fact they are caused by other parts of the front end of your car. The most general circumstance is that your drive shafts are damaged and move, this vibration will be felt in the steering wheel. Don’t forget to verify the level of wear of your drive shafts to exclude this hypothesis.
